Horizon Media Reports Data Breach to Vermont Attorney General

Horizon Media officially reported a data security incident to the Vermont Attorney General on May 6, 2026. This report indicates that personal information was involved, though specific details about the breach type and data compromised remain unspecified. Individuals who received a notification from Horizon Media should review it for guidance.
